1. I have discussed the latest Hong Kong telegram with the Chief Clerk and Mr Burns. It is agreed that it would not be good tactics to go now for a new quota for Hong Kong, even on the restricted lines suggested by the Governor. We should, however, make clear in the submission and letter to No 10 that Hong Kong does have considerable concerns and that the potential problems (eg of the net outflow being reversed) are considerable. The Secretary of State's decision on reverting to a possible future quota should be firmly stated and in the submission we should make clear that we have in mind re-examining the problem in late June.
2. Would Mr Williamson please propose changes to the existing draft submission and letter (the latest Hong Kong telegram should be one of the flags). Mr Burns wants to put this to Mr Donald if possible this evening.
2.
We should also be ready to send a telegram to Hong Kong / in reply when the submission has gone up and the Secretary of State's views are known.
